Solana Testnet Activates SIMD-0437 Phase 1: Storage Costs Set to Plummet 90%
TREE NEWS reports: On August 28, Solana’s core development team Anza announced that the Solana testnet has activated the first phase of the SIMD-0437 proposal, marking the beginning of testing for the account rent reduction mechanism. This proposal comprises five feature gates, with only the first one currently active; the full adjustment has not yet been deployed to mainnet. Once all five phases are completed, Solana’s per-byte storage cost parameter, lamports_per_byte, will drop from 6,960 to 696 — a 90% reduction. For token accounts, the deposit required to maintain a rent-exempt status is expected to fall from approximately $0.16 to $0.016, significantly lowering the cost of account creation and application deployment.
News Summary
The SIMD-0437 proposal aims to overhaul Solana’s storage economics. Currently, the network charges rent based on a high per-byte rate, which acts as a barrier for new users and developers. By reducing the parameter by an order of magnitude, Solana intends to make storage more affordable, potentially spurring greater adoption and on-chain activity.
Industry Analysis and Implications
This development is a critical step toward making Solana more competitive, especially against other layer-1 blockchains like Ethereum and emerging alternatives. Lower storage costs directly benefit:
- Retail users: Creating new token accounts or interacting with dApps becomes cheaper, lowering the entry barrier.
- Developers: Deploying smart contracts and storing state will be significantly less expensive, encouraging more complex and data-heavy applications.
- DeFi protocols: Reduced overhead for liquidity pools, vaults, and other stateful contracts could improve capital efficiency and attract more liquidity.
From a market perspective, this move reinforces Solana’s narrative as a high-performance, low-cost blockchain. It may also pressure other networks to reconsider their own fee structures, fostering a more competitive ecosystem.
